The new company is reported to have 22 employees. M23 is based at the same factory in Ciserano, Bergamo, Italy. ) has spun-off its military submarine business into a new company, M23 SRL. It has since emerged that GSE are the builder, but under a spin-off company called M23 SRL. I initially I speculated that one of Italy's three special forces type submarine builders, Drass, CABI Cattaneo, or GSE Trieste were the actual builder. However it was unlikely that Qatar was buying a Fincantieri design, which tend to be full-size subs. A MoU (memorandum of understanding) was signed with Fincantieri in Janurary mentions the "the supply of cutting-edge naval vessels and submarines." The deal was originally reported in February 2020as relating to Italy's main defense shipbuilder, Fincantieri. I suspect that some level of training support may also be included.
